One cup of Poppy seed is around 134 grams and contains approximately 706 calories, 24 grams of protein, 56 grams of fat, and 38 grams of carbohydrates.

Poppy Seed is a tiny, flavorful seed derived from the opium poppy, with origins in Mediterranean and Middle Eastern cuisines. Rich in healthy fats, fiber, and essential minerals like calcium and magnesium, Poppy Seed adds a delightful crunch and nutty flavor to dishes. Often used in baking and as a garnish, it pairs beautifully with breads, pastries, and salads. However, it's important to consume them in moderation due to potential psychoactive effects and their history of association with opium.
